Early Morning Start –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Wake Up Before Sunrise
Your exciting day begins at 5:00 AM – 6:00 AM. You enjoy breakfast at your lodge to gather energy for the trek.
Travel to the Park Headquarters
Depending on your sector, you drive to the UWA briefing center:
-
Buhoma
-
Ruhija
-
Rushaga
-
Nkuringo
Arriving early ensures enough time for briefings and allocation.
The Briefing –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Registration and Group Assignment
At 7:00 AM, all trekkers gather at the park headquarters. Rangers brief you on:
-
Gorilla behavior
-
Trekking rules
-
Safety measures
-
Gorilla family you will trek
This is an important step in What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est because it determines how tough or relaxed your trek will be.
Allocation Based on Fitness
Bwindi’s terrain varies. Rangers allocate gorilla families depending on your fitness level:
-
Easier groups for beginners
-
Moderate groups for average fitness
-
Challenging groups for seasoned hikers
Hire a Porter (Highly Recommended)
One of the best tips in What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est is hiring a porter. They help carry your bag and support you on steep, slippery terrain.
Entering the Forest –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Trekking Begins Around 8:00 AM
With your rangers and trackers, you begin walking into the thick rainforest. The trails can be:
-
muddy
-
slippery
-
steep
-
narrow
-
sometimes nonexistent
This is where the “Impenetrable Forest” earns its name.

Finding the Gorillas –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Trackers Locate Gorillas in Advance
Professional trackers start early in the morning to locate the gorilla families. They guide rangers and tourists to the right direction.
Trekking Duration Varies
Expect your trek to last:
-
30 minutes (if gorillas are nearby)
-
2–4 hours (average)
-
6+ hours (if gorillas move deeper)
This unpredictability is an important part of What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est.
Final Approach
As you approach the gorillas, porters remain behind and you continue with your ranger for the final steps.
The Gorilla Encounter –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- One Life-Changing Hour with a Gorilla Family
Once you find the mountain gorillas, you are allowed one full hour with them. Expect to see:
-
Silverbacks showing dominance
-
Mothers nursing babies
-
Young gorillas playing
-
Feeding and grooming interactions
This moment is emotional, peaceful, and unforgettable.
Photography Expectations
You can take photos with:
-
Camera
-
Smartphone
-
GoPro
No flash is allowed. The dense vegetation and mist create beautiful photography conditions.
Maintain 10-Meter Distance
This rule protects both you and the gorillas from illness. Rangers guide you on where to stand.
After the Gorilla Encounter –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Return Hike
After an hour with the gorillas, you hike back through the forest. The return journey often feels easier due to excitement and adrenaline.
- Trek Completion
Depending on the trek length, you may finish by:
-
11:00 AM
-
1:00 PM
-
3:00 PM
Some long treks finish later.
Receive a Gorilla Trekking Certificate
Every trekker receives a certificate recognizing their incredible achievement. This is an important part of What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est.

What to Pack –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Recommended Gear
Pack:
-
Waterproof hiking boots
-
Long trousers
-
Long-sleeved shirt
-
Rain jacket
-
Gardening gloves
-
Bug repellent
-
Snacks & water
-
Camera
Optional Gear
-
Gaiters
-
Walking stick
-
Extra battery
-
Backpack

Difference Between Bwindi and Mgahinga – What to Expect on a Gorilla Trekking Day in Bwindi Forest
- Bwindi Offers More Gorilla Families
Bwindi has more than 20 habituated families, giving travelers more booking options.
Longer, More Adventurous Treks
Bwindi’s terrain is more challenging but also more rewarding.
- Mgahinga Offers a Volcano Setting
Mgahinga treks take place on volcanic slopes and are sometimes shorter.
Both deliver unforgettable experiences.
